The Backbone of Nvidia’s Supercomputing Revolution

At the heart of Nvidia’s supercomputing advancements is its state-of-the-art GPU technology, primarily designed for rendering high-quality graphics. However, over the years, Nvidia’s GPUs have found applications beyond the realm of gaming and visualization, proving to be indispensable for HPC workloads. The key innovation lies in the parallel processing power of GPUs. Unlike traditional central processing units (CPUs), which handle tasks sequentially, GPUs can perform thousands of operations simultaneously, making them ideal for solving complex problems in scientific simulations, deep learning models, and data-intensive tasks.

Nvidia’s most notable contribution to supercomputing is its CUDA (Compute Unified Device Architecture) platform, which allows developers to write software that can harness the full power of GPUs for high-performance computing. CUDA has become a widely adopted framework in the scientific community, accelerating research in various domains by enabling faster computation and reducing the time required to process large datasets.

Revolutionizing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ning

Nvidia’s supercomputers have been at the forefront of AI and machine learning (ML) advancements, which are revolutionizing scientific research. Deep learning algorithms, which form the backbone of AI, require enormous computational power to analyze vast amounts of data. Nvidia’s GPUs excel in this area, providing the speed and efficiency necessary for training sophisticated AI models.

Researchers and scientists are increasingly turning to Nvidia-powered supercomputers to solve complex problems that were once thought to be intractable. In fields like drug discovery and genomics, AI-driven systems powered by Nvidia’s GPUs are able to analyze biological data at a pace and accuracy previously unimaginable. This technology is speeding up the discovery of new treatments for diseases like cancer, Alzheimer’s, and genetic disorders. Nvidia’s deep learning platforms are also improving diagnostic systems by enabling real-time analysis of medical imaging, leading to more accurate and faster diagnoses.

Accelerating Climate Science and Environmental Modeling

The power of Nvidia’s supercomputers extends beyond human health to address the global challenge of climate change. Climate modeling involves simulating intricate patterns and interactions in the atmosphere, oceans, and land systems. These simulations require massive computational resources, and Nvidia’s GPUs are helping researchers model complex climate phenomena with unparalleled precision.

Nvidia’s supercomputers are enabling more accurate climate predictions by processing vast datasets more efficiently. Researchers can now create high-resolution models of weather patterns and environmental systems, allowing them to make better-informed decisions regarding climate policy, resource management, and disaster preparedness. For example, Nvidia-powered systems are used to predict the impacts of climate change on ecosystems, agriculture, and biodiversity. This research is critical for developing strategies to mitigate the effects of climate change and protect vulnerable populations and ecosystems.

Advancing Fundamental Physics and Astrophysics

In the realm of fundamental physics, Nvidia’s supercomputers are helping scientists explore some of the most profound questions about the universe. The study of particle physics, quantum mechanics, and cosmology involves incredibly complex simulations and calculations that require immense computational power. Nvidia’s GPUs are enabling breakthroughs in these areas by providing the necessary horsepower to model subatomic particles, simulate quantum systems, and analyze astronomical data.

One of the most notable examples of Nvidia’s influence in fundamental physics is its contribution to the Large Hadron Collider (LHC) at CERN. The LHC generates massive amounts of data from particle collisions, and Nvidia’s GPUs are used to process this data in real-time. These GPUs help researchers analyze particle behavior and search for new particles, such as the elusive Higgs boson, which was discovered in 2012. Nvidia’s GPUs are also being used to simulate quantum systems, which could lead to the development of quantum computers capable of solving problems far beyond the reach of classical computers.

Astrophysicists are also benefiting from Nvidia-powered supercomputers. The study of the cosmos requires processing enormous datasets from telescopes and space probes. Nvidia’s GPUs are used to accelerate simulations of cosmic events such as black hole formation, supernovae, and the dynamics of galaxy formation. These simulations help scientists better understand the fundamental forces of nature and the evolution of the universe.

Transforming Healthcare with Precision Medicine

Another area where Nvidia’s supercomputers are having a profound impact is in the field of healthcare, particularly in precision medicine. The goal of precision medicine is to tailor medical treatments to individual patients based on their genetic makeup, lifestyle, and environmental factors. This approach requires the processing of vast amounts of genomic data, clinical records, and medical imaging, all of which can be accelerated using Nvidia’s GPUs.

Nvidia’s supercomputers are enabling the rapid analysis of genomic sequences, allowing researchers to identify genetic mutations and potential therapeutic targets. In cancer research, for example, AI models trained on Nvidia-powered systems can analyze medical images to detect tumors at earlier stages, improving the chances of successful treatment. Additionally, these systems are being used to simulate drug interactions at the molecular level, potentially speeding up the drug discovery process.
